Abstract

A diversity antenna for use with a portable host device such as a laptop computer, for example as part of a PCMCIA card pluggable into the laptop computer to enable wireless computer by the laptop computer, includes a main antenna and a diversity antenna. Various configurations for these antennas are possible, including the use of a balanced dipole as the main antenna element and a split diversity antenna for the diversity antenna element. The diversity antenna provides high isolation between the antenna elements and isolation from interfering self-noise generated by the host device.

Claims (26)

1. A diversity antenna system for use with a host device and configured to provide isolation from radiated self-noise by the host device and to minimize interactions between antenna elements of the diversity antenna system, the diversity antenna system comprising:

a ground plane;

a main antenna coupled to the ground plane and comprising a dual-band symmetrical center fed dipole; and

a diversity antenna coupled to the ground plane and configured to operate as a top loaded monopole.

2. The system of claim 1 , wherein the main antenna comprises a low band component and a high band component.

3. The system of claim 2 , wherein at least a portion of one of the low band and high band components is configured to be elevated relative to a surface of the system that is closest to a user of the system such that SAR (Specific Absorption Rate) to the user is minimized.

4. The system of claim 1 , wherein the main antenna is inductively coupled to the ground plane.

5. The system of claim 4 , wherein the inductive coupling is through a loop balun.

6. The system of claim 1 , wherein the host device is a laptop computer.

7. The system of claim 1 , wherein the host device is a portable telephone.

8. The system of claim 1 , wherein the host device is a personal digital assistant.

9. The system of claim 1 , wherein the main antenna is formed on a FPCB (flexible printed circuit board) which is configured to have a three-dimensional shape.

10. The system of claim 1 , further comprising an RF connector oriented orthogonally to the ground plane.

11. A diversity antenna system for use in a wireless communication device removably pluggable into a host device, the diversity antenna system comprising:

a ground plane;

a main antenna coupled to the ground plane and having at least one portion that is configured to be elevated relative to a surface of the wireless communication device that is closest to a user of the system such that SAR (Specific Absorption Rate) to the user is minimized; and

a diversity antenna coupled to the ground plane and configured to operate as a top loaded monopole.

12. The system of claim 11 , wherein the main antenna is inductively coupled to the ground plane.

13. The system of claim 12 , wherein the inductive coupling is through a loop balun.

14. The system of claim 11 , wherein the wireless communication device is a PCMCIA (personal computer memory card international association) card.
